Psilocybin’s Long-Term Effects: A Glimpse into the Psyche
A study published in Nature Communications has sparked interest in psilocybin’s potential therapeutic benefits. Researchers at UC San Francisco and Imperial College London found that a single dose of this psychedelic substance can produce lasting changes in brain activity, structure, and function.
The study measured “brain entropy,” or the variety and unpredictability of neural activity, during the psychedelic experience. Participants who experienced greater increases in brain entropy reported more personal insight and improved well-being in the weeks following. This suggests that the psychedelic experience itself may contribute to psilocybin’s therapeutic potential.
For years, research has shown that psychedelics can reduce symptoms of depression, anxiety, and addiction. The study’s findings suggest that these benefits may not be limited to short-term effects but could also be influenced by long-term changes in brain structure and function.
The researchers used a unique design to compare the effects of a full psychedelic dose with those observed after a placebo. This allowed them to isolate the effects of psilocybin itself, rather than simply observing changes associated with taking a substance. The results are significant because they suggest that psilocybin can produce lasting changes in brain activity and structure.
Measuring the subjective experience has long been a challenge in studying psychedelics. However, the researchers used a range of methods, including EEG, fMRI, and DTI, to examine brain activity, connectivity, and structure. These measures provided insights into the mechanisms by which psychedelics exert their therapeutic effects.
The study’s findings suggest that psilocybin may have an adaptogenic effect on the brain, loosening up entrenched patterns of thought and promoting greater flexibility in cognitive processing. This is a key finding because it provides insights into how psychedelics may be able to “reset” the brain, allowing individuals to break free from maladaptive patterns of thinking.
